Can You Replace ST215/75R17.5 Trailer Tires on Front Axle Only on Tandem Axle Trailer  

Question:

Ive got relatively new tires on a tandem axle fifth wheel trailer - 2 years old, 4,000 miles. One of the tires doesnt look right - has a hop. I would like to buy two new tires of a better brand and put them on the front axle. The new and old tires are the same size, load rating, speed rating, ply construction, thread pattern, and pressure spec. Any issues or concerns? The tires would be 215/75R17.5, 16 ply, H load rating, L speed rating (75 mph) Thanks.

Expert Reply:

Yes you can; if you want to change the 215/75R17.5 tires on just the front axle of your tandem axle trailer you can without issue. The absolute ideal would be to change all four at the same time for perfect, even wear across the tires, but it isn't necessary so long as the tires on the rear axle are in good shape.

In fact, if you are going to change tires on one of the axles, you would want it on the front axle, as that is the one that bears the most most. And we do have a really good option for new 215/75R17.5 tires:
